New-AzCostManagementQueryFilterObject
Создание объекта в памяти для QueryFilter
Синтаксис
New-AzCostManagementQueryFilterObject
[-And <IQueryFilter[]>]
[-Dimensions <IQueryComparisonExpression>]
[-Not <IQueryFilter>]
[-Or <IQueryFilter[]>]
[-Tag <IQueryComparisonExpression>]
[<CommonParameters>]
Описание
Создание объекта в памяти для QueryFilter
Примеры
Пример 1. Создание объекта фильтра запроса для экспорта управления затратами
$orDimension = New-AzCostManagementQueryComparisonExpressionObject -Name 'ResourceLocation' -Value @('East US', 'West Europe')
$orTag = New-AzCostManagementQueryComparisonExpressionObject -Name 'Environment' -Value @('UAT', 'Prod')
New-AzCostManagementQueryFilterObject -or @((New-AzCostManagementQueryFilterObject -Dimensions $orDimension), (New-AzCostManagementQueryFilterObject -Tag $orTag))
And :
Dimension : Microsoft.Azure.PowerShell.Cmdlets.Cost.Models.Api20211001.QueryComparisonExpression
Not : Microsoft.Azure.PowerShell.Cmdlets.Cost.Models.Api20211001.QueryFilter
Or : {Microsoft.Azure.PowerShell.Cmdlets.Cost.Models.Api20211001.QueryFilter, Microsoft.Azure.PowerShell.Cmdlets.Cost.Models.Api20211001.QueryFilter}
Tag : Microsoft.Azure.PowerShell.Cmdlets.Cost.Models.Api20211001.QueryComparisonExpression
Эта команда создает объект фильтра для экспорта управления затратами.
Параметры
-And
Логическое выражение "AND". Должно быть не менее 2 элементов. Сведения о создании см. в разделе NOTES для свойств AND и создании хэш-таблицы.
Тип: | IQueryFilter[] |
Position: | Named |
Default value: | None |
Обязательно: | False |
Принять входные данные конвейера: | False |
Принять подстановочные знаки: | False |
-Dimensions
Имеет выражение сравнения для измерений. Сведения о создании см. в разделе NOTES для свойств DIMENSIONS и создании хэш-таблицы.
Тип: | IQueryComparisonExpression |
Position: | Named |
Default value: | None |
Обязательно: | False |
Принять входные данные конвейера: | False |
Принять подстановочные знаки: | False |
-Not
Логическое выражение NOT. Сведения о создании см. в разделе NOTES для свойств NOT и создании хэш-таблицы.
Тип: | IQueryFilter |
Position: | Named |
Default value: | None |
Обязательно: | False |
Принять входные данные конвейера: | False |
Принять подстановочные знаки: | False |
-Or
Логическое выражение OR. Должно быть не менее 2 элементов. Сведения о создании см. в разделе NOTES для свойств OR и создании хэш-таблицы.
Тип: | IQueryFilter[] |
Position: | Named |
Default value: | None |
Обязательно: | False |
Принять входные данные конвейера: | False |
Принять подстановочные знаки: | False |
-Tag
Имеет выражение сравнения для тега. Сведения о создании см. в разделе NOTES для свойств TAG и создании хэш-таблицы.
Тип: | IQueryComparisonExpression |
Position: | Named |
Default value: | None |
Обязательно: | False |
Принять входные данные конвейера: | False |
Принять подстановочные знаки: | False |
Выходные данные
Azure PowerShell
Обратная связь
https://aka.ms/ContentUserFeedback.
Ожидается в ближайшее время: в течение 2024 года мы постепенно откажемся от GitHub Issues как механизма обратной связи для контента и заменим его новой системой обратной связи. Дополнительные сведения см. в разделеОтправить и просмотреть отзыв по